
Worked on improving map interaction stability for the vkoves/electrify-chicago repository, focusing on resolving a specific issue affecting Desktop Safari users. Addressed a bug where tap interactions caused unexpected behavior by implementing a Safari-specific stability guard, which disables tap interactions on that platform while leaving other environments unaffected. This targeted fix enhanced the reliability of the map experience and reduced potential support requests from users on Desktop Safari. All changes were delivered in a single, traceable commit to maintain clear project history. The work leveraged Vue.js and JavaScript, demonstrating attention to cross-browser compatibility and careful risk management in front end development.
